Responsibilities

  • Lead the 2026 Roadmap: Define the architectural vision and technical milestones for the company's flagship AI products, ensuring scalability and innovation.
  • Design Scalable Systems: Design and implement robust deep learning pipelines capable of processing real-time data at scale, optimizing for latency and throughput.
  • Model Engineering: Spearhead the development and fine-tuning of Large Language Models (LLMs) and multimodal AI agents.
  • Cloud & MLOps: Oversee the deployment of models on major cloud platforms (AWS/GCP) and establish CI/CD pipelines for automated model training and deployment.
  • Ethical AI Governance: Establish and enforce frameworks for AI bias, transparency, and data privacy to ensure responsible AI deployment.
  • Technical Mentorship: Mentor a team of junior data scientists and engineers, fostering a culture of continuous learning and technical excellence.

Qualifications

  • Education: Master’s degree in Computer Science, Artificial Intelligence, or a related quantitative field (PhD preferred).
  • Experience: 7+ years of experience in software engineering, with at least 4 years specifically in AI/ML architecture and leadership.
  • Technical Skills: Deep expertise in Python, PyTorch, TensorFlow, and modern deep learning frameworks.
  • Cloud Mastery: Proven experience architecting solutions on AWS, GCP, or Azure, with a strong grasp of Kubernetes and containerization.
  • Problem Solving: Demonstrated ability to solve complex, unstructured problems in dynamic environments.
  • Communication: Exceptional ability to articulate complex technical concepts to executive stakeholders and product teams.
